Bahrain - Export of Parts of Automatic Goods-Vending Machinery
Since 2013, Bahrain Export of Parts of Automatic Goods-Vending Machinery decreased by 68.3% year on year. With $1,700 in 2017, the country was ranked number 72 comparing other countries in Export of Parts of Automatic Goods-Vending Machinery. Bahrain is overtaken by El Salvador, which was number 71 with $1,756 and is followed by Cyprus with $1,596.75. China ranked the highest with $209,003,241.08 in 2019, a growth of 28.5% compared to 2018. Italy, Netherlands and Israel resp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Georgia witnessed the best average annual growth at +185.6% per year, while Brunei recorded the worst performance at -73.8% per year.
